    Ingredients:
    400g onions finely sliced.
    300g gram flour (besan or chickpea four)
    1 tablespoon of dried fenugreek leaves (kasoori meethi)
    1 teaspoon + 1/4 teaspoon salt
    1 teaspoon of the following:
    Coriander powder
    Deghi mirch (Kashmiri chilli powder)
    Garam masala
    Dried chilli flakes
    1/2 teaspoon turmeric powder
    1.5 tablespoons of coriander seeds and cumin seeds coarsely ground.
    A good handful of fresh chopped coriander
    Oil to fry
    Water

    Just goes to show there are more ways of doing this. I make my batter for bhajis quite thin; not quite tempura but close to it. I have never made them with batter as stiff as here. Spices, yes; my own garam masala and a balti spice mix which is good for most applications. I use to go to the Lahore restaurant in east London years ago and their bhajis were made with my style of near tempura batter. I think a stiff batter runs the risk of too much floppy stodge in the middle.
